> Per Noa's suggestion I got a book on Living Well with Hypothyroidism by Mary Shomon. "Normal" goes up to 5.5 TSH, but some people think that there are a lot of hypothyroid people included in those samples. Maybe the numbers ought to be more like 1 or 2. Also, as Noa says each individual has a particular need.
> It could be that you have enough T4 but not T3, the more active form. Dr. Bob's psychopharmacology tips has some info there. Peter Whybrow did some research on treating rapid cycling patients with hypermetabolic doses---above what endocrinologists would consider normal.
